California Adoption Laws


More Information on Adoption Laws

Code Section Family §§8500-9340; No
Who May Be AdoptedAny unmarried minor child at least 10 years younger than prospective adoptive parent or parents; any married minor or adult
Age that Child's Consent Needed12 years and older
Who May AdoptAny adult; must be 10 years older than child unless stepparent, sister, brother, aunt, uncle, or first cousin and court approves
Home Residency Required Prior to Finalization of Adoption?No
State Agency/CourtState Department of Social Services/Superior
Statute of Limitations to ChallengeOn any grounds except fraud: 1 year; fraud: 3 years
